x86: Add apic->x86_32_early_logical_apicid()

On x86_32, the mapping between cpu and logical apic ID differs
depending on the specific apic implementation in use.  The
mapping is initialized while bringing up CPUs; however, this
makes early inits ignore memory topology.

Add a x86_32 specific apic->x86_32_early_logical_apicid() which
is called early during boot to query the mapping.  The mapping
is later verified against the result of init_apic_ldr().  The
method is allowed to return BAD_APICID if it can't be determined
early.

noop variant which always returns BAD_APICID is implemented and
added to all x86_32 apic implementations.

diff --git a/arch/x86/include/asm/apic.h b/arch/x86/include/asm/apic.h
index d1aa0c3..efb073b 100644
--- a/arch/x86/include/asm/apic.h
+++ b/arch/x86/include/asm/apic.h
@@ -354,6 +354,20 @@ struct apic {
 	void (*icr_write)(u32 low, u32 high);
 	void (*wait_icr_idle)(void);
 	u32 (*safe_wait_icr_idle)(void);
+
+#ifdef CONFIG_X86_32
+	/*
+	 * Called very early during boot from get_smp_config().  It should
+	 * return the logical apicid.  x86_[bios]_cpu_to_apicid is
+	 * initialized before this function is called.
+	 *
+	 * If logical apicid can't be determined that early, the function
+	 * may return BAD_APICID.  Logical apicid will be configured after
+	 * init_apic_ldr() while bringing up CPUs.  Note that NUMA affinity
+	 * won't be applied properly during early boot in this case.
+	 */
+	int (*x86_32_early_logical_apicid)(int cpu);
+#endif
 };
 
 /*
@@ -501,6 +515,11 @@ extern struct apic apic_noop;
 
 extern struct apic apic_default;
 
+static inline int noop_x86_32_early_logical_apicid(int cpu)
+{
+	return BAD_APICID;
+}
+
 /*
  * Set up the logical destination ID.
  *
diff --git a/arch/x86/kernel/apic/apic.c b/arch/x86/kernel/apic/apic.c
index ae08246..3127079 100644
--- a/arch/x86/kernel/apic/apic.c
+++ b/arch/x86/kernel/apic/apic.c
@@ -1250,8 +1250,13 @@ void __cpuinit setup_local_APIC(void)
 
 #ifdef CONFIG_X86_32
 	/*
-	 * APIC LDR is initialized.  Fetch and store logical_apic_id.
+	 * APIC LDR is initialized.  If logical_apicid mapping was
+	 * initialized during get_smp_config(), make sure it matches the
+	 * actual value.
 	 */
+	i = early_per_cpu(x86_cpu_to_logical_apicid, cpu);
+	WARN_ON(i != BAD_APICID && i != logical_smp_processor_id());
+	/* always use the value from LDR */
 	early_per_cpu(x86_cpu_to_logical_apicid, cpu) =
 		logical_smp_processor_id();
 #endif
@@ -1991,7 +1996,10 @@ void __cpuinit generic_processor_info(int apicid, int version)
 	early_per_cpu(x86_cpu_to_apicid, cpu) = apicid;
 	early_per_cpu(x86_bios_cpu_apicid, cpu) = apicid;
 #endif
-
+#ifdef CONFIG_X86_32
+	early_per_cpu(x86_cpu_to_logical_apicid, cpu) =
+		apic->x86_32_early_logical_apicid(cpu);
+#endif
 	set_cpu_possible(cpu, true);
 	set_cpu_present(cpu, true);
 }
